Test No. 5

  1. Remove the power window main switch. Check continuity when each switch on the power window main switch is operated to UP or DOWN position. See Fig 1 . Is the power window main switch normal? If YES, go to next step. If NO, replace the power window main switch. When the power window sub-switch is operated, the power windows should open or close normally.
    Fig 1: Testing Power Window Main Switch Passenger Window Continuity
    G00306906Courtesy of MITSUBISHI MOTOR SALES OF AMERICA.
  2. Check the power window lock switch. Is the power window lock switch at the UNLOCK position? If YES, go to next step. If NO, operate the power window lock switch to the UNLOCK position. When the power window sub-switch is operated, the power windows should open or close normally.
  3. Check which door window is not opened or closed. Which door window is not opened or closed? If front passenger window is inoperative, go to next step. If left rear passenger window is inoperative, go to step  17 . If right rear passenger window is inoperative, go to step  30 .
  4. Check right side front power window sub-switch for continuity. Remove right side power window sub-switch. Check continuity when the right side front power window sub-switch is moved to UP or DOWN position. See Figure . See RIGHT FRONT POWER WINDOW SUB-SWITCH RESISTANCE TEST  table. Is the right front power window sub-switch normal? If YES, go to next step. If NO, replace the right front power window sub-switch. When the right front power window sub-switch is operated, the right front power window should open or close normally.
    RIGHT FRONT POWER WINDOW SUB-SWITCH RESISTANCE TEST

    Switch Position Terminals No. Specification
    Up 4 & 5; 6 & 7 Less Than 2 Ohms
    Off 4 & 5; 6 & 8 Less Than 2 Ohms
    Down 4 & 7; 6 & 8 Less Than 2 Ohms
  5. Check the right front power window motor. Remove the right front power regulator assembly. See POWER WINDOW MOTOR  under REMOVAL & INSTALLATION. Connect a battery to the indicated motor terminals and check that the motor runs freely. See RIGHT FRONT POWER WINDOW MOTOR TEST  table. Is the right front power window motor normal? If YES, go to next step. If NO, replace the right front power regulator/motor assembly. When the front power window sub-switch is operated, the right front power window should open or close normally.
    RIGHT FRONT POWER WINDOW MOTOR TEST

    Terminal Connections Slider Position
    1 (+); 2 (-) Up
    1 (-); 2 (+) Down
  6. Check at front power window sub-switch connector E-05 in order to check the power window relay circuit of the power supply to the right front power window sub- switch. Disconnect right front power window sub-switch connector E-05, and measure voltage at the harness side between terminal No. 7 and ground. See Figure . Measured value should be approximately 12 volts. Does the measured voltage correspond with this range? If YES, go to step  9 . If NO, go to next step.
  7. Check power window relay connector C-92 and right front power window sub-switch connector E-05 for damage. Are power window relay connector C-92 and right front power window sub-switch connector E-05 in good condition? See Figure and Figure . If YES, go to next step. If NO, repair or replace the connector. When the right front power window sub-switch is operated, the right front power window should open or close normally.
  8. Check the wiring harness between power window relay connector C-92 and right front power window sub-switch connector E-05. See Figure andFigure . See WIRING DIAGRAMS  . Also check junction block connector C-87 and intermediate connector C-72. See Figure and Figure . If junction block connector C-87 or intermediate connectors C-72 is damaged, repair or replace the connector. Is the wiring harness between power window relay connector C-92 and right front power window sub-switch connector E-05 in good condition? If YES, no action is necessary. If NO, repair the wiring harness. When the right front power window sub-switch is operated, the right front power window should open or close normally.
  9. Check at right front power window sub-switch connector E-05 in order to check the ground circuit to the right front power window sub-switch. Disconnect right front power window sub-switch connector E-05, and measure at the harness side. Measure the resistance value between terminal No. 8 and ground. See Figure . The measured value should be 2 ohms or less. Does the measured resistance value correspond with this range? If YES, go to step  12 . If NO, go to next step.
  10. Check power window main switch connector E-16 and right front power window sub-switch connector E-05 for damage. Are power window main switch connector E-16 and right front power window sub-switch connector E-05 in good condition? If YES, go to next step. If NO, repair or replace the connector. When the right front power window sub-switch is operated, the right front power window should open or close normally.
  11. Check the wiring harness between power window main switch connector E-16 and right front power window sub-switch connector E-05. Also check intermediate connectors C-68 and C-72. If intermediate connector C-68 or C-72 is damaged, repair or replace the connector. Is the wiring harness between power window main switch connector E-16 and right front power sub-switch connector E-05 in good condition? If YES, replace the power window main switch. If NO, repair the wiring harness. When the right front power window sub-switch is operated, the right front power window should open or close normally.
  12. Check at right front power window sub-switch connector E-05 in order to check the ground circuit to the right front power window sub-switch. Disconnect right front power window sub-switch connector E-05, and measure at the harness side. Measure the resistance value between terminal No. 5 and ground. See Figure . The measured value should be 2 ohms or less. Does the measured resistance value correspond with this range? If YES, go to step  15 . If NO, go to next step.
  13. Check power window main switch connector E-16 and right front power window sub-switch connector E-05 for damage. Are power window main switch connector E-16 and right front power window sub-switch connector E-05 in good condition? If YES, go to next step. If NO, repair or replace the connector. When the right front power window sub-switch is operated, the right front power window should open or close normally.
  14. Check the wiring harness between power window main switch connector E-16 and right front power window sub-switch connector E-05. Also check intermediate connectors C-68 and C-72. If intermediate connectors C-68 or C-72 is damaged, repair or replace the connector(s). Is the wiring harness between power window main switch connector E-16 and right front power sub-switch connector E-05 in good condition? If YES, replace the power window main switch. If NO, repair the wiring harness. When the right front power window sub-switch is operated, the right front power window should open or close normally.
  15. Check right front power window sub-switch connector E-05 and right front power window motor connector E-04 for damage. Are right front power window sub-switch connector E-05 and right front power window motor connector E-04 in good condition? If YES, go to next step. If NO, repair or replace the connector. When the right front power window sub-switch is operated, the right front power window should open or close normally.
  16. Check the wiring harness between right front power window sub-switch connector E-05 and right front power window motor connector E-04. Is the wiring harness between right front power window main switch connector E-05 and right front power window motor connector E-04 in good condition? If YES, no action needs to be taken. If NO, repair the wiring harness. When the right front power window sub-switch is operated, the right front power window should open or close normally.
